Temple Emanu-El of New York is a synagogue at 1 East 65th Street on the Upper East Side of Manhattan, at the northeast corner with Fifth Avenue, in New York City, New York, in the United States. It was built in 1928–1930 for the Reform Jewish Congregation Emanu-El of New York. With capacity for 2,500 seated worshippers, it is one of the ... The adventure continued in the magical …With only thirty-three German Jewish immigrants, Temple Emanu-El humbly began on Grand and Clinton Streets in 1845. Marking a Meaningful Moment.Congregation Emanu-El of Westchester traces its history back to 1952 and the Westchester School for Judaism. Originally conceived as a school dedicated to the teaching of Judaism, the “School” also conducted High Holy Day services as early as 1953 in the private homes of its members. At Temple Emanu-El, we encourage our members, young and old, to gather in an atmosphere both warm and awe-inspiring, as we share our moments of joy as well as our times of sadness, immerse ourselves in the richness and beauty of our tradition, and act upon our …Organ in temple at 110 East 12th Street: Henry Erben. New York City (1858) Mechanical action. 3 manuals, 37 stops, 43 ranks. From 1854-1868, Temple Emanu-El was located at 110 East 12th Street in the former Twelfth Street Baptist Church.
